**About us**:
The Faculty of Music is Canada's largest and most renowned university-based music program for professional musical training, creation, performance, education, and research. Home to a diverse and dynamic community of scholars, performers, composers, and educators, the University of Toronto's Faculty of Music offers a supportive community in one of the world’s most diverse and dynamic cities. We provide a superb learning environment, an internationally renowned teaching faculty, multiple performance halls, and an outstanding music library collection. With degrees and diplomas available in numerous areas of study, our array of courses and programs provides our 900 students an exceptional opportunity to explore various fields within music. With over 600 concerts and events annually, the Faculty is an exciting and vibrant place to work, study, and visit.

Our faculty members include musicians who perform on the world’s most prestigious stages and record for major labels, scholars who present at leading international conferences and publish with top presses, educators who offer workshops and masterclasses at universities and conservatories worldwide, and composers whose works are performed by renowned ensembles and commissioned by acclaimed musicians and arts organizations.

**Your opportunity**:
The Faculty of Music is a great place to work. It has such a positive energy that comes from faculty, students and staff pursuing their love for and of music. We are small and hard-working team. We love what we do, and we work collaboratively to support our faculty and students in their musicmaking.

Under the direction of the Director of Operations, Performance, and Facilities, the incumbent will provide their technical acumen and will be responsible for overseeing the day-to-day operational and performance space needs at the Faculty of Music. Duties will include overseeing the day-to-day theatre operations ensuring that a safe working environment is maintained, planning and implementing a season performance schedule, maintaining and repairing theatre equipment, designing and fabricating custom production scenery, editing production documentation, analyzing, and recommending changes to rental fees, and planning and estimating financial resources required for programs and/or projects. In addition you will be responsible for picking up and dropping equipment and supplies to and from the theatre. Lastly, the incumbent will act as back up support for theatre technicians and other department colleagues, as required.

**Your responsibilities will include**:

- Analyzing processes and recommending changes for more efficient coordination of operations
- Implementing a rollout plan for the season performance schedule
- Conducting routine inspections of assigned facilities
- Implementing production activities according to plans and schedules
- Analyzing production set drawings
- Paying close attention to occupational safety precautions
- Coordinating the production of CAD drawings
- Planning and estimating financial resources required for programs and/or projects

**Essential Qualifications**:

- Bachelor's Degree or acceptable combination of equivalent experience.
- Minimum five (5) years experience in theatre operations required including overseeing day-to-day operational, design and production needs of performance spaces.
- Experience overseeing all technical aspects of a theatre such as rigging, lighting, audio, video, costuming, scenic painting, and props.
- Experience analyzing technical operation activities and requirements for a theatre and recommending changes for improvement.
- Experience analyzing technical specifications (for example, design documents) in preparation for production labour and material cost estimates for theatre projects and or productions.
- Experience planning and estimating financial resources required for programs and/or projects within a theatre environment.
- Experience designing and fabricating custom production scenery and analyzing production set drawings.
- Experience scheduling and assigning work to a small group in a limited area, including short-term contractors within an theatre environment.
- Experience participating in routine inspections to ensure adherence to occupational safety standards as it pertains to theatre operations.
- Excellent organizational and time management skills.
- Excellent interpersonal skills and the ability to build and maintain strong relationships.
- Excellent problem-solving skills, the ability to liaise and work collaboratively with stakeholders and contractors.
- Demonstrated working knowledge of the Ontario Health and Safety Act and the regulations and guidelines which pertain to work in the theatre environment.
